2015: Started 11 games as a senior goalkeeper…went 5-4-1 with a goals against average of 1.48…recorded two shutouts…saved 45 shots in 975 minutes of playing time…recorded eight saves in a shutout victory over UNE on September 4…notched a shutout against GNAC foe Albertus Magnus on October 3…named GNAC Goalkeeper of the week on October 5.
2014: Played in 18 games starting all 18 as a junior goalkeeper…recorded a 2.05 goals against average with a .733 save percentage…allowed 35 goals and made 96 saves in 1533:00 minutes of play between the pipes…went 4-12-with four shutouts on the year.
2013: Started and played in 16 games…recorded a 1.42 goals against average with a .656 save percentage…allowed 22 goals and made 42 saves in 1390:00 minutes of play…went 9-6-1 with three shutouts, facing 129 shots…named to GNAC Honor Roll on September 16th…turned back four shots in a 90 min shutout against Southern Maine to win 3-0…ranks third all-time in career goals against average (1.32), fourth in victories (17) and shutouts (6), and fifth in save percentage (.800).
2012: Started 14 games as a freshman goalkeeper…posted a 1.20 goals against average with an .800 save percentage…allowed 18 goals and made 72 saves in 1345:51 between the pipes…went 8-4-2 with three shutouts and faced 209 total shots as a rookie…listed on the GNAC Weekly Honor Roll on October 8th…faced 22 shots with seven saves and one goal allowed in his first NCAA start against UMass.-Dartmouth on September 1st…logged 96:46 minutes in net in the 1-0 OT loss to the Corsairs that afternoon…made a career-high 14 saves in a 2-2 deadlock with Thomas College on September 6th…registered his first collegiate victory after making three saves in a 2-1 OT win over Mount Ida College on September 15th…tallied seven stops in a 2-1 double-overtime win over Norwich University on October 6th… posted consecutive shutout efforts with nine total saves in identical 1-0 victories over Anna Maria College and Endicott College on October 8th and 10th, respectively…made several key stops, and six overall, in a 2-1 upset triumph over Lasell College on October 22nd…his 1.20 GAA currently ranks as the fourth-best single-season average in program history.
High School: Played four years of varsity soccer for Gabe Lawson at Post Falls High School, making the state playoffs two years…was an All-Inland Empire League First Team member all four years…led his team to a program-best 17-2-2 record as a senior…earned IEL Newcomer of the Year as a sophomore, claimed IEL Goalkeeper of the Year as a junior and earned IEL Defender of the Year as a senior…selected as a team captain his junior and senior years...also played football, basketball and baseball…received Academic Sport Scholar accolades as a senior.
